Blackboard tests are automatically graded and entered into Grade Center. Surveys are essentially the same as tests, but student results are anonymous and they are not graded.
On the Tests, Surveys, and Pools page, select Pools. On the Pools page, select Build Pool. Complete the Pool Information page and select Submit. To add questions, you can use Create Questions, Find Questions, and Upload Questions.

Question pools are groupings of questions that instructors can create and add to their assignments. Often instructors will create multiple question pools and add random questions from each pool to an assignment.
